  • Basic Characteristics

     

    The immersion technology provides a uniform coupling method.
    The beam can be focused according to user needs to improve the sensitivity of detecting small reflectors.
    The corrosion-resistant 303 stainless steel casing features chrome-plated brass connectors.
    The patented RF shielding function can enhance the signal-to-noise ratio characteristics of critical applications.
    Spherical (point) focusing or cylindrical (line) focusing is available.
    The quarter-wavelength matching layer increases the output of acoustic energy.

    Model Classification

     

    Point Focusing Probe
    The organic glass or cured epoxy resin in front of the probe chip is processed into a spherical shape, and the sound beam converges at a point on the axis.
    Line Focusing Probe
    The line focusing immersion probe has a cylindrical surface, and the sound beam converges into a line perpendicular to the axial direction.
    Flat Probe
    The probe has a flat surface without focusing.

    Probe Detection Report

     

    Provides users with objective and accurate product quality and performance indicator information.
    We evaluate the probes according to the ASTM-E1065 standard and provide customers with corresponding test reports corresponding to the serial numbers, used to record the actual RF waveform and frequency spectrum of each probe. 
    Each test chart includes data such as center frequency, peak frequency, -6dB relative bandwidth and pulse width. The content in the certificate is traceable.
